The PRUbalanced Fund is a combination of an equity fund and a fixed income fund that seeks to provide capital
growth and regular income. Through the PRUbalanced Fund, you can invest in a mixed portfolio of equities and
fixed income securities.
|
The great thing about the PRUbalanced Fund is that it offers the best of
both worlds - the growth potential of equities and the regular income of fixed-income securities at the
convenience of a single investment.
The best part about the PRUbalanced Fund is its low investment capital outlay. All you need is a small
initial capital of RM 1000.
If you are an investor who has moderate risk tolerance and your aim is to gain capital appreciation and
enjoy meaningful income distribution, then the PRUbalanced Fund is ideal for you.

Some basic fees:
| Service Charge |
- |
5% of Selling Price |
| |
| Redemption Charge |
- |
Nil |
| |
| Annual Management Fee |
- |
1.5% p.a. on Gross Net Asset Value calculated on a daily basis. |
| |
| Annual Trustee Fee |
- |
0.1% p.a. on Gross Net Asset Value calculated on a daily basis. |
| |
| Switching Fee |
- |
Applicable when you switch units from one fund to another. 1% of the redemption money
subject to a maximum of RM100. However, there will be two free switches in each calendar year for each
investor. |
| |
| Transfer Fee |
- |
You can transfer units to another investor at no cost. |
